What are Private Comments?
Comments are a powerful tool for engaging with students and their families. Depending on the type of Space you are using, comments can be open discussions or private reflections. This article explains how comment permissions work across Class, 1:1, Group, and Reporting Spaces.
Comment Visibility by Space Type
The visibility of comments depends on the Space where the post is located.
Space Type | Who can see comments? |
|---|---|
Class Space | All students selected for the post, and their linked families (if the Space is Active) |
1:1 Space | Only the teacher and the individual student |
Reporting Space | Only the teacher and the individual student |
Group Space | Only the members of that specific group and their linked families |

Class Spaces
Within a Class Space, if you select multiple students or the entire class, everyone shares a single copy of the post. This post has one combined comment section.
- Visible for students: Only teachers can add comments.
- Active for students: Students can comment and respond to each other.
- Teacher control: Teachers can configure whether students view and comment on posts created by other students. This setting applies to individual student posts, not posts shared across the whole class. For more details on adjusting these permissions, see How can I update Space settings?.
1:1 and Reporting Spaces
In 1:1 and Reporting Spaces, teachers can add posts for multiple students at once, such as a broadcast announcement. However, this creates a separate copy of the post in each student's personal space.
- Privacy: Tags and comments added to these posts are never visible to other students or their families.
- Independence: Edits made in one student's 1:1 Space do not appear in any other student's account.
Group Spaces
When posting to Group Spaces, teachers select one or more groups. This creates a separate copy of the post for each group.
- Group visibility: Comments are visible to all students in that group and their linked family members.
- Isolation: Students in one group can never see posts or comments from other groups.
Good to Know
Students and family members can never view or add comments on other students' posts in 1:1 spaces, reporting spaces, or other groups' posts in group spaces. To share content for the entire class to discuss together, use the Class Space. You can also copy a post from another space into your Class Space as a teacher.
